Australian PM-'Salaam Namaste' Bollywood !

Australian Prime Minister John Howard will get a taste of Bollywood fever when he meets the cast and crew of an Indian movie filmed in Victoria.
As he continues a four-day tour of India, Mr Howard will fly from New Delhi to Mumbai, the nation's commercial and entertainment capital, where he will address a business luncheon.
He will have a change of pace when he meets some of the cast and the director of Salaam Namaste, which stars Australian Tania Zaetta.
Australia is keen to encourage Indian film-makers Down Under, believing it will also lure Indian holiday-makers.
"The Indian entertainment industry is accessing Australia's expertise in film production and services - and featuring Australian cities in its movies, which must now be familiar to many
Indian moviegoers," Mr Howard said in a speech.
"Around 40 Indian films have now been shot in Australia since 1998, which can only bring our countries and cultures closer together."
